Tinubu Had Nine Trips To France Since 2023, Seven Of Them For Medical Reasons — Arnold Insists On Ill Health Claims, Months After Alleging Cancer Diagnosis

A former mayor of Blanco, Texas, Mike Arnold, has alleged that Bola Ahmed Tinubu made nine trips to France since 2023, with seven of those visits reportedly for medical reasons.

Arnold, who had earlier claimed a stage three cancer diagnosis, insisted that the trips were linked to ongoing health concerns rather than routine official engagements.

Arnold had recently alleged that Bola Tinubu travelled to Paris, France in January 2026 for stage three cancer treatment, contrary to official statements that the trip was for diplomatic engagements.

Arnold made the claim in a circulating online commentary, arguing that Nigerians were not being told the true purpose of Tinubu’s visit.

According to Arnold, the revelation was made by confidential sources.

‘’Confidential sources say Tinubu is seriously ill not overworked, not jet-lagged, sick. It’s said advanced cancer at least stage three, and that’s from older intel. The Paris trips aren’t diplomatic. They’re medical. This is common knowledge in the real corridors of Abuja. The question stopped being “whether” a long time ago.’’

The Nigerian presidency had earlier announced that Tinubu’s Paris trip was for high-level consultations with international partners.

In a new post he made on the health of the former Lagos governor, Arnold wrote “Nine trips to France since 2023. Seven of them medical,” insisting that Bola Ahmed Tinubu is suffering from serious ill health.

Arnold referenced reporting attributed to SaharaReporters and other sources, which also linked the travel pattern to repeated medical visits, alongside claims of significant international travel spending running into ₦36 billion within a single fiscal year.

He further argued that official explanations do not align with the reported frequency and duration of the trips.

According to the claims, the trips reportedly followed a recurring cadence between 2023 and 2025 — including visits in January, May, and September 2024, as well as October and November 2024, and February, April, June, and August 2025. Some of the trips were said to last between one and 19 days, with longer stays described as more intensive periods.

Arnold also referenced a September 2024 incident where footage allegedly showed the Nigerian leader being assisted into a vehicle outside St. Mary’s Lindo Wing in London. He further questioned a June 2025 visit to Saint Lucia, which he described as a possible “decoy” state engagement, suggesting it may have been arranged to allow private medical access.

He claimed the pattern resembles a structured medical cycle, describing it as similar to “21-day chemotherapy routines stretched across continents,” though these assertions remain speculative and unverified.

He also questioned the management of governance during the periods of absence, making further claims about informal power arrangements, while no official evidence has supported those assertions.
